Transaction 56f306de8225a1ba5cf058d9a74f6a1280dbdb5191e7adc175c73bb1e1542786
1 Input
1 Output
-
56f306de8225a1ba5cf058d9a74f6a1280dbdb5191e7adc175c73bb1e1542786:0
- value
- 258548
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7c928307731142b5651fe729da40c4650cdc83a
- address
- bc1qulyjsvrhxy2zk4j3leefmfqvgegvmjp6a6r3qs